Soddy-Daisy shop provides automotive work for specialty vehicles

George Aslinger III is owner of Custom Concept Motor Sports in Soddy-Daisy. Aslinger's shop provides service for specialty vehicles as well as automotive work for most cars.

• Name: Custom Concept Motor Sports

• Location: 8656 El Dee Lane, Soddy-Daisy

• Contact information: 423-508-8711, Custom conceptmotorsports.com

• Products/services: Service and repair for any car, specializing in high-performance vehicles

• Age: Owner George Aslinger III opened his business in November 2009. He moved into his larger, newer location in November 2011.

• Startup investment: Aslinger and his family bought the building for about $250,000. They invested an additional $10,000 in finishing the site.

• Target market: Anyone needing automotive work, particularly those with high-performance vehicles. “We can service anything from mom’s Honda minivan to an exotic car,” Aslinger said.

• Five-year goal: Work on more high-performance vehicles

• Biggest hurdle: Competing with Internet retailers. When purchasing car parts online, customers can avoid paying sales tax. Aslinger said that cuts into his parts sales and sometimes forces him to lower his margins. “We try to accommodate whatever the customer wants,” he said. “If we do have to lose some of our markup on stuff, hopefully they’ll be repeat customers and we can make an impression on them in the long run.”

• Biggest reward: Having a larger space.

• Lesson learned: Running an auto shop takes a lot more than car knowledge. Aslinger said he talks to young people all the time who dream about running their own shop, so he explains the commitment required. “You’re getting to work on cars all day, sometimes sports cars, but it’s not really the case all the time,” he said. “It’s a lot of time you don’t get to spend with the family at night.”
